Bug 464242

Summary: Tracks of an artist that lack album tag set aren't shown
Product: [Applications] Elisa Reporter: Daniel Kraus <bovender>
Component: generalAssignee: Matthieu Gallien <matthieu_gallien>
Status: CONFIRMED ---    
Severity: normal CC: jackhill3103, nate
Priority: NOR    
Version First Reported In: 22.12.1   
Target Milestone: ---   
Platform: Neon   
OS: Linux   
Latest Commit: Version Fixed/Implemented In:
Sentry Crash Report:
Attachments: Artist page mockup. Albums by the artist, and albums featuring the artist are separated. There is a section for tracks that have the artist tag set, but don't have an album tag.

Description Daniel Kraus 2023-01-13 15:28:41 UTC
SUMMARY

Tracks without album information do not appear when clicking on artist name in artist view.

STEPS TO REPRODUCE
1. Switch to artist view.
2. Click on an artist where the associated tracks to not have album information.
3. Elisa says "nothing to display".
4. However, when clicking on the "play" button overlay on the artist icon, the track(s) get added to the playlist and are being played.

OBSERVED RESULT

"Nothing to display" (because there are not albums)

EXPECTED RESULT

The track(s) should be shown, i.e., the "album" level should be skipped, jumping to a list of tracks.

SOFTWARE/OS VERSIONS
Operating System: KDE neon 5.26
KDE Plasma Version: 5.26.5
KDE Frameworks Version: 5.101.0
Qt Version: 5.15.8
Kernel Version: 5.15.0-57-generic (64-bit)
Graphics Platform: X11
Comment 1 Jack Hill 2023-01-23 14:40:33 UTC
Some music apps have an artists page that show the albums and tracks in two separate lists. (Typically the albums are a grid view, and tracks are a list view). I think that would be a good way of fixing this problem.
Comment 2 Jack Hill 2023-03-16 13:09:19 UTC
Created attachment 157334 [details]
Artist page mockup. Albums by the artist, and albums featuring the artist are separated. There is a section for tracks that have the artist tag set, but don't have an album tag.

I made a quick mockup of a potential new artists page. I also split the albums into "Albums by <artist>" and "Albums featuring <artist>" since this is something that bugs me.
Comment 3 Nate Graham 2023-03-27 18:49:37 UTC
I'd like it!